Intel issues yet another official statement about the 13th/14th Gen CPU stability issues, promises to fix them via a microcode patch
In May 2024, Intel issued an official statement about the stability issues of its 13th and 14th gen CPUs. Back then, Intel was claiming that the stability issues were due to incorrect BIOS profiles. However, that turned out to be false. And today, the blue team issued yet another official statement about these issues.
